Written Answers. - Child Pornography.

Gay Mitchell

Question:

813 Mr. G. Mitchell asked the Minister for Justice, Equality and Law Reform if his attention has been drawn to a report which states that Ireland is second among EU countries in the number of attempts to access child pornographic websites on the Internet;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[1353/99]

I am aware of the existence of this report, which was commissioned by the European Union and is being carried out by the Focus on Children organisation.

Following recent media reporting on certain aspects of the report prior to its publication, senior officials from my Department and from the Garda authorities met with the director of Focus on Children, Mr. Seán Lawless, and requested a copy of the report so that its full implications for this country can be assessed by my Department and the Garda. The report is still awaited.
